Market Growth Overview

The solar EV charging market is being driven by multiple factors including the accelerated adoption of EVs, government incentives for green energy, and rising awareness about climate change. Solar-powered chargers provide a reliable, off-grid solution for EV owners, reducing electricity costs while supporting energy independence. Additionally, urban areas are increasingly incorporating solar charging stations in parking lots, highways, and commercial spaces, further boosting demand.

Technological developments such as higher-efficiency photovoltaic panels, energy storage solutions, and smart grid integration are helping solar EV chargers become more effective and user-friendly. The ability to store energy during the day and charge vehicles even at night is a significant value addition.


Key Trends Shaping the Solar EV Charging Market

1. Integration with Smart Grid Systems

Modern solar EV chargers are being integrated with smart grids to optimize energy distribution. This allows better management of peak load demands, dynamic pricing, and enhanced reliability for users.

2. Rising Adoption of Residential Solar Chargers

With declining solar panel costs, residential solar EV chargers are becoming increasingly popular. Homeowners can now harness solar power to charge their vehicles directly, reducing reliance on public charging networks.

3. Expansion of Public Solar Charging Infrastructure

Municipalities and private companies are investing in public solar charging stations to cater to the growing EV population. These stations are often installed in urban hubs, shopping complexes, and along highways.

4. Development of Fast Solar Chargers

The market is also witnessing advancements in fast-charging solar systems that can reduce charging time significantly while maintaining efficiency. These chargers combine solar panels with high-capacity batteries for continuous availability.

FAQs

1. What are solar EV charging systems?

Solar EV charging systems use solar panels to generate electricity, which charges electric vehicles sustainably and efficiently.

2. Can solar EV chargers work at night or during cloudy days?

Yes, most systems use energy storage solutions like batteries to store solar energy for use when sunlight is unavailable.

3. Are solar EV chargers cost-effective?

Over time, solar EV chargers reduce electricity costs and provide long-term savings, making them a cost-effective solution for EV owners.
